import numpy as np
import cuda_filters
arr3d = np.random.rand(512, 512, 512).astype(np.float32)
filter_size = 5 # 3, 5, or 7
mode = 'mirror' # clamp, border, mirror, or wrap
result = cuda_filters.medfilt3(arr3d, filter_size, mode)
In a test environment with Intel Core i7-4790K and NVIDIA TITAN X(Pascal), cuda_filters.medfilt3
(shown above) took about 0.88 secs and scipy.ndimage.median_filter
(code shown below) took about 154 secs.
from scipy.ndimage import median_filter
result = median_filter(arr3d, size=filter_size, mode=mode)
